App 打包封装:让你的应用程序走向成功

移动应用程序(Mobile App)已经成为人们日常生活中不可或缺的一部分。在开发和发布应用程序时,我们需要面临的一个挑战是如何将其打包封装,使其能够顺利地运行在不同的设备上。这篇文章将探讨App 打包封装的重要性,以及如何实现高效的App 打包封装。

什么是App 打包封装?

App 打包封装是一种技术,用于将应用程序转换为可以在不同平台上运行的格式。这个过程涉及到对应用程序的代码、资源和配置文件进行修改和优化,以便于其能够在不同的设备和操作系统上运行。

为什么需要App 打包封装?

在开发和发布应用程序时,我们需要面临的一个挑战是如何将其打包封装,使其能够顺利地运行在不同的设备上。这个问题的解决方案是App 打包封装。通过App 打包封装,我们可以使应用程序在不同平台上运行,提高用户体验和满足不同需求。

App 打包封装的优点

  1. 跨平台支持:App 打包封装可以将应用程序转换为可以在不同平台上运行的格式,从而实现跨平台支持。
  2. 高效开发:通过App 打包封装,我们可以减少开发时间和成本,提高开发效率。
  3. 用户体验:App 打包封装可以使应用程序在不同平台上运行,提高用户体验和满足不同需求。

如何实现高效的App 打包封装

  1. 选择合适的打包工具:选择合适的打包工具是实现高效App 打包封装的关键。常见的打包工具包括Xamarin、React Native和Flutter等。
  2. 优化代码:对应用程序的代码进行优化,以便于其能够在不同平台上运行。
  3. 资源管理:对应用程序的资源进行管理,以便于其能够在不同平台上运行。

App 打包封装的挑战

  1. 兼容性问题:App 打包封装可能会遇到兼容性问题,例如不同的设备和操作系统之间的差异。
  2. 性能问题:App 打包封装可能会遇到性能问题,例如应用程序在不同平台上运行时的性能差异。

App 打包封装是实现移动应用程序跨平台支持和高效开发的关键技术。通过选择合适的打包工具、优化代码和资源管理,我们可以实现高效的App 打包封装。兼容性问题和性能问题仍然需要我们注意和解决。

参考文献

  1. Xamarin官方文档:https://docs.microsoft.com/en-us/xamarin/
  2. React Native官方文档:https://reactnative.dev/
  3. Flutter官方文档:https://flutter.dev/

字数:1067